org.apache.struts.action
Class ActionMessages.ActionMessageItem

java.lang.Object
  extended by org.apache.struts.action.ActionMessages.ActionMessageItem
All Implemented Interfaces:
Serializable
Enclosing class:
ActionMessages

protected class ActionMessages.ActionMessageItem
extends Object
implements Serializable

This class is used to store a set of messages associated with a property/key and the position it was initially added to list.

See Also:
Serialized Form

Field Summary
protected  int iOrder
          The position in the list of messages.
protected  List list
          The list of ActionMessages.
protected  String property
          The property associated with ActionMessage.
 
Constructor Summary
ActionMessages.ActionMessageItem(List list, int iOrder, String property)
          Construct an instance of this class.
 
Method Summary
 List getList()
          Retrieve the list of messages associated with this item.
 int getOrder()
          Retrieve the position in the message list.
 String getProperty()
          Retrieve the property associated with this item.
 void setList(List list)
          Set the list of messages associated with this item.
 void setOrder(int iOrder)
          Set the position in the message list.
 void setProperty(String property)
          Set the property associated with this item.
 String toString()
          Construct a string representation of this object.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

list

protected List list

The list of ActionMessages.


iOrder

protected int iOrder

The position in the list of messages.


property

protected String property

The property associated with ActionMessage.

Constructor Detail

ActionMessages.ActionMessageItem

public ActionMessages.ActionMessageItem(List list,
                                        int iOrder,
                                        String property)

Construct an instance of this class.

Parameters:
list - The list of ActionMessages.
iOrder - The position in the list of messages.
property - The property associated with ActionMessage.
Method Detail

getList

public List getList()

Retrieve the list of messages associated with this item.

Returns:
The list of messages associated with this item.

setList

public void setList(List list)

Set the list of messages associated with this item.

Parameters:
list - The list of messages associated with this item.

getOrder

public int getOrder()

Retrieve the position in the message list.

Returns:
The position in the message list.

setOrder

public void setOrder(int iOrder)

Set the position in the message list.

Parameters:
iOrder - The position in the message list.

getProperty

public String getProperty()

Retrieve the property associated with this item.

Returns:
The property associated with this item.

setProperty

public void setProperty(String property)

Set the property associated with this item.

Parameters:
property - The property associated with this item.

toString

public String toString()

Construct a string representation of this object.

Overrides:
toString in class Object
Returns:
A string representation of this object.


Copyright © 2000-2008 Apache Software Foundation. All Rights Reserved.